Specifications
| Product Specifications | |
|---|---|
| Positions | 12 |
| Type | Resettable Thermal Breaker Block |
| Max Voltage | 48V DC |
| Max Input Amperage | 100A |
| Max Output Amperage per Circuit | 25A |
| Input Stud Size | M5 |
| Output Stud Size | M4 |
| Terminal Material | Nickel-plated copper |
| Hardware Material | Stainless steel |
| Base Material | Polycarbonate |
| Mounting Dimensions | 6.61" x 3.54" |

How does a breaker block differ from a fuse box?
A breaker block utilizes resettable thermal breakers that can be manually reset after an overload event, restoring power immediately. A fuse box uses sacrificial fuses that must be replaced entirely when they blow, interrupting power until a new fuse is installed.
